Materials.

This free succulent coaster pattern is super flexible — you can use any yarn fiber you have on hand! Whether it’s cottonacrylic, or a cotton blend, it’ll still turn out adorable. You can even mix and match scraps to give it that fun, textured look.

In this example.

  • Yarn: I use scrap yarn, weight DK or 4 medium  cotton blend, or you can substitute for any yarn weight u like and fiber content.
  • The example size is 4 inches from top leaf to bottom coaster DK weight: if u use 4 medium weight the size will be 5 inches.
  • Crochet hook: size 4.0 mm.

Skills & Abbreviations.

You will need to know how to make (American crochet term).

  • sc, which means single crochet
  • ch Chain
  • slip knot
  • sk means skip-stitch
  • dc, which means double crochet
  • puff stitch, which means yarn over then pull up a loop 3 time,s then pull the loops to finish the puff st crochet

The easiest leaf coaster crochet pattern instruction.

Pick up a crochet hook size 4.0 mm and start off by making a chain of four, then join the chain to create the circle.

Row1. ch3 count as a st then make 5dc in the ring, then ch1 and make 6dc in the ring then, ch1 ,sc in the ring and sl st to join the row.

Row2. ch3 count as a st then make 1dc in the ch3 space from the previous row, then make 2dc in each st untl you are at the ch1 space from the previous row ( the peak point of the leaf make 2dc,ch1,2dc now we will make 2dc in each st until end od row at the end make 1sc and sl st to join the row.

(28 st of dc)

Row3. ch3, then make 1 puff st in ch3 space from the previous row, then (ch1,sk1 st and make 1puff st in the next st) repeat this (*) until we are at peak point of the leaf we make 1puff,ch2,1puff then we will repeat (*) until end of the row, at the end we will make sc then sl st to join the row.

Row4. ch3, make ( 1 sc in the space from the previous row then make 2sc on top of each puff st) repeat (*) until we at peak point of the leaf we make 2sc,ch1,2sc, then repeat (*) until end of row, at the end we make sc then sl st to join the row and fasten off.

Pot plant/basket.

crochet basket pot plant for coaster

Round1. Make magic ring and 7sc in ring (7)

Round2. 2sc in each st around (14)

Round3. *Sc in next st, 2sc in next st*      and repeat from * around (21)

Round4. *Sc in next 2 st,2sc in next st*    and repeat from * around (28)

Round5. in back loop only: Sc in each st around (28)

Round 6- 14. Work in both loops: Sc in each st around (28), finished off. And you can roll the top edge to create the layer for the pot plant.
